Default Turn Signal stays on

My right hand turn signal stays on constantly after using it this evening. I turned full lock to lock several times and still stays on. I already have an appointment tomorrow morning for an oil change, so the dealership will be looking at it first thing

sounds like it could be the steering wheel angle position switch.

It was some switch on the steering column. Replaced and problem solved. I'm just glad it decided to fail the evening before I had an appointment.

My right turn signal quit at 36,500 miles. It would blink 3 times only no matter what I did. (2011 FX4 Ecoboost). The dealer estimated $300 to replace a switch (telephone estimate). I decided to live with it. Now the truck has 46,000 miles on it and the blinker started working again.
